예제 #1
0
 ChainStatus Optimizations.ITailEnd <T> .WhereSelect <S>(ReadOnlySpan <S> source, Func <S, bool> predicate, Func <S, T> selector)
 {
     ToListImpl.WhereSelect(source, Result, predicate, selector);
     return(ChainStatus.Filter);
 }
예제 #2
0
 ChainStatus Optimizations.ITailEnd <T> .WhereSelect <Enumerable, Enumerator, S>(Enumerable source, Func <S, bool> predicate, Func <S, T> selector)
 {
     ToListImpl.WhereSelect <S, T, Enumerable, Enumerator>(source, Result, predicate, selector);
     return(ChainStatus.Filter);
 }
예제 #3
0
 public ChainStatus WhereSelect <S>(List <S> source, Func <S, bool> predicate, Func <S, T> selector)
 {
     ToListImpl.WhereSelect(source, Result, predicate, selector);
     return(ChainStatus.Filter);
 }